How to add a dropdown list in the table copied from excel? I have a list I have copied from excel now I need to add dropdown list to one of the column. I was to update the list with the dropdown value as this change.
It there a in-built macros that I can use to archive this?
Hi @Mzzhsl ,
There are no any built-in macros that allow you to create dropdown lists in Confluence. But there are a lot of apps with similar functionality.
For example, you may check the Handy Macros for Confluence app and its Handy Status macro. The macro allows you to create a predefined list of statuses, insert them inside you table cells and switch them from the page view mode.
Unfortunately, there is nothing similar that I can come up with with the standard Confluence tools.
A kind of a workaround is to create templates with instructional text where you list all the available variants of the cell info for your users to choose from and manually type in.
